Sec. 542.001. DEFINITIONS. In this chapter:
(1)"Breach of system security" has the meaning assigned by Section 521.053 .
(2)"Exemplary damages" has the meaning assigned by Section 41.001 , Civil Practice and Remedies Code.
(3)"Personal identifying information" and "sensitive personal information" have the meanings assigned by Section 521.002 .

Legislative History
Added by Acts 2025, 89th Leg., R.S., Ch. 1029 (S.B. 2610 ), Sec. 1, eff. September 1, 2025.
